Force of Nature Meats Grass Fed Beef Ancestral Blend Review
Force of Nature Meats Grass Fed Beef Ancestral Blend is a ground beef product featuring 8% liver and heart from regeneratively raised, 100% grass-fed cattle. It is designed for use in burgers, tacos, and general cooking, catering to those seeking nutrient-dense meat options. This product fits within the specialty category of regenerative meat products.
The blend includes organ meats to enhance nutritional value and supports a regenerative production process. It is suitable for health-conscious consumers and offers convenience through online availability for subscription or one-time purchase. The product ships frozen with dry ice to maintain freshness during delivery, reflecting practical considerations for direct-to-consumer meat sales.
Priced at $14.99 USD, this blend represents a premium option for consumers interested in regenerative meat products. It is marketed primarily through Force of Nature Meats’ e-commerce platform, which includes subscription plans. The product’s positioning and features make it relevant for those seeking sustainable, nutrient-rich meat alternatives as part of their dietary choices.

Force of Nature Meats Heritage Slow-Growth Chicken Breasts Review
Force of Nature Meats Heritage Slow-Growth Chicken Breasts are boneless, skinless cuts from a heritage breed raised on pasture with organic feed. The chicken is free from antibiotics and added hormones, catering to consumers seeking naturally raised poultry. This product fits within the specialty slow-growth poultry category emphasizing sustainable farming practices.
This item supports health-conscious preparation with its pasture-raised and organic-fed attributes. It suits various general cooking needs and is available through both subscription and one-time purchase options. The frozen product is shipped packed with dry ice to preserve freshness during delivery, aligning with Force of Nature Meats Review expectations.
Priced at $16.99 USD, the Heritage Slow-Growth Chicken Breasts offer a sustainable choice for consumers focused on regenerative and responsibly sourced meats. The product's availability online adds convenience for those prioritizing naturally raised poultry. Its delivery method and purchasing flexibility provide added value for its target audience.

Force of Nature Meats Ancestral Blends Box Review
The Force of Nature Meats Ancestral Blends Box is a comprehensive bundle featuring 16 ancestral blend meat products that include beef, bison, venison, chicken, sausages, and meatballs. It is designed for consumers seeking a variety of nutrient-dense meat options without the need for extensive preparation. This bundle falls within the regenerative meat and meat products category, emphasizing sustainability and nutrition.
This product is compatible with the Force of Nature Meats Review ecosystem as it offers functionality through regenerative organ meat blends that support energy and muscle function. The bundle is available for purchase both as a one-time order or via subscription, enhancing convenience and regular access to nutrient-rich meats. All items are shipped frozen with dry ice to maintain freshness.
Priced at $218 USD, the Ancestral Blends Box caters to consumers looking for nutrient-dense regenerative meat options with the flexibility of subscription savings. It is distributed exclusively through the official Force of Nature Meats online platform with shipment limited to the United States. This product suits customers prioritizing regenerative agriculture and enhanced nutrition.

Force of Nature Meats Shipping Policy
Force of Nature Meats ships frozen products across the United States using insulated packaging with dry ice to maintain temperature. Shipping is available Monday through Wednesday from multiple warehouse locations. This method ensures the quality of their regenerative meat products during transit.
Free shipping applies to orders over $189, though exact delivery timelines and tracking details are not provided. Meat products cannot be returned due to safety regulations, and customers should be aware of potential shipping challenges such as thawing or delayed delivery.
